Asheville Gathers to Celebrate Coach Vette’s Remarkable Career
Asheville, NC—The atmosphere was buzzing with excitement as Asheville High School opened its doors on January 3, 2025, for a ceremony dedicated to the recently renovated gymnasium floor. This special event honored the incredible legacy of Coach Sonita Warren-Dixon, affectionately known as Coach Vette. The dedication took place in between thrilling boys’ and girls’ varsity basketball games against Erwin High School, making it a perfect occasion for the Asheville community to come together in support of their heroes.
A Coach with a Legacy Spanning 34 Years
For an impressive 34 years, Coach Vette has been a shining star within Asheville City Schools. Her extensive coaching repertoire spans various sports, including basketball, volleyball, track, field hockey, and softball. During her tenure, she has led the Asheville Cougars to countless victories, instilling a sense of pride and accomplishment in the school’s athletic programs that will be remembered for generations.
